Introduction

In today's dynamic corporate environment, strategic financial management is crucial for steering companies towards sustained growth and stability. This course is designed to equip senior financial leaders and decision-makers with advanced tools and methodologies to align financial strategy with corporate objectives, optimise investment decisions, manage risks, and restructure business for strategic advantage. Participants will emerge with practical insights and strategic financial skills, enhancing their ability to influence and direct their organisations' financial pathways effectively.

Who should attend

This course is tailored for Senior Business Executives, Project Managers, and Financial Leaders who are engaged in business planning and strategic decision-making. Ideal participants include those with a foundational knowledge of financial accounting and concepts, seeking to refine their strategic financial management capabilities. This course will benefit professionals aiming to guide their organisations towards a prominent role in the competitive global marketplace.

COURSE PROFILE

Strategic Financial Alignment

  • Defining corporate financial objectives
  • Aligning financial strategies with business goals
  • Identifying key strategic financial KPIs
  • Analysing the interplay between corporate and financial planning
  • Assessing corporate governance impacts on financial strategy

Financing Corporate Ventures

  • Exploring debt financing options
  • Evaluating equity finance opportunities
  • Balancing debt-equity ratios for optimal financing
  • Tailoring financing decisions to project lifecycles
  • Applying financial models to real-world scenarios

Optimising Investment Decisions

  • Applying discounted cash flow analysis
  • Utilising ROI and NPV in investment decisions
  • Recognising biases in capital investment appraisals
  • Managing risks in financial decision-making
  • Exploring alternative investment appraisal techniques

Managing Risks in Financial Strategy

  • Integrating risk management with financial strategies
  • Identifying financial risks and mitigation tactics
  • Employing hedging strategies for financial risks
  • Exploring the implications of risk on capital structure
  • Developing a comprehensive risk management framework

Strategic Business Restructuring

  • Navigating mergers and acquisitions
  • Forming and managing joint ventures and alliances
  • Strategising for effective refinancing and divesting
  • Evaluating restructuring opportunities
  • Implementing change in corporate structure
